
* {
  margin:0;
  padding:0;
}

html, body, p {
  font: 100% "calibri", Garamond, 'Comic Sans';
}

#kopfbereich {
  background-color:#D5F4E2;
  height:100;
 /* border:1px dotted #900; */
}

#kopfbereich p {
  font-size:2em;
  text-align:right;
  color:#1AB49E;
  padding:.4em .4em 0 0;
}

#steuerung {
  background-color:#1AB49E;
  color:white;
  padding:6px;
  padding-left:1em;

  /* border:1px dotted #900;  */
}

#steuerung a:link {
  color:white;
  /* #145049*/
  text-decoration:none;
}

#steuerung a:visited {
  color:#A01C71;
  text-decoration:none;
}

#schatten {
  background:url(../bilder/schattenwurf-grau-v.png) repeat-x;
  height:12px;
 /* border:1px dotted #900;  */
}

#inhalt {
  padding:2em;

 /* border:1px dotted #900;*/
}

#inhalt h1, h2, h3, p, ul, ol {
  padding-bottom:.7em;
 /* color: #3F3F3F;  */
}
#ex-absatz {
 padding-bottom:.7em;
 width: 800px;
 /*border: 1px solid blue; */
}
#ex-absatz p, ul {
 padding-bottom:.7em;
}

#inhalt h4 {
  padding-top: 1em;
}

#inhalt ul, ol {
  padding-left:2em;
}

/*#inhalt li {
  padding-bottom:1em;
} */

#inhalt a:link {
  color:#009090;
  /* #145049*/
  text-decoration:none;
}

#inhalt a:visited {
  color:#A02020;
  text-decoration:none;
}

#bild {
    float:right;
    position:relative;
    font-size:small;
    /*margin:1em;   */
    background-color:#D5F4E2;
    color:#1C9A82;
}

#toc {
    width: 400px;
    margin-left: 3em;
    margin-right: 3em;
    margin-bottom: 1em;
    padding: 1em;
    background-color:#D5F4E2;
    color:#1C9A82;
}


h1, h2, h3, h4, p, ul, ol {
    padding-bottom: 6px;
}

li {
    padding-bottom: 2px;
}

#aufgaben table, td, th {
    border: 1px solid #1AB49E;
}

#aufgaben h3, h4 {
   padding-top: 20px;
}

td {
  padding: 8px;
}

#themen_spalte {
    margin: 3em;
    padding: 20px;
    background-color:#D5F4E2;
    color:#1C9A82;
    text-align: center;
    width: 250px;
}

#themen_spalte_inaktiv {
    margin: 3em;
    padding: 20px;
    background-color:#F0F0F0;
    color:#A0A0A0;
    text-align: center;
    width: 250px;
}


#themen_leer {
    border: none;
    width: 60px;
}

#codebeispiel {
    width: 400px;
    font: 100% 'Courier New' bold;
    margin: 1em;
    background-color:#F0F0F0;
    color:#1C9A82;
    padding: .5em;

}

#beispiel {
    width: 820px;
    margin-left: 2em;
    margin-right: 3em;
    margin-bottom: 1em;
    padding: 1em;
    background-color:#D5F4E2;
    color:#1C9A82;
}